Sanitation collection only observes 6 major holidays each year.
- New Years Day
- Memorial Day
- Independence Day (July 4th)
- Labor Day
- Thanksgiving Day
- Christmas
If one of the listed holidays occurs Monday through Friday, sanitation pickup days will occur one day later than normal after the holiday. This will also affect all pickup days following in that week. If the holiday falls on a Saturday or Sunday, the schedule will not be affected.
Minor holidays such as: Martin Luther King Day, Presidents Day, Good Friday or Veterans Day will not affect your sanitation pick up.
For example: Memorial Day falls on a Monday; trash pickup citywide will be delayed by one day. This means that residents with normal pickup scheduled on Monday will be picked up on Tuesday, Tuesday will be picked up on Wednesday, etc. Residents who have a normal Friday pickup will have their trash picked up on Saturday.
